Output c37f91151b44ea5f79b820ef9c6aefcc2fa5e6fed37c10b54735a0c65e1a0e15:19

value
509390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8443f5ff05f7743188b5d17576e460aed5b1b4cb OP_EQUAL
address
3DkNXsbCtWKnjwQF1sZ75c6xKEqED1L4AR
transaction
c37f91151b44ea5f79b820ef9c6aefcc2fa5e6fed37c10b54735a0c65e1a0e15
confirmations
153783
spent
true